About

Winery Notes Our Yamhill-Carlton Chardonnay is a true expression of this variety in Oregon, with bright acidity, great energy and depth. This wine is 100% estate grown, coming from the Gran Moraine Vineyard tucked in the western foot hills of the coast range. Tasting Notes This white wine exhibits aromas of peach, apple blossom, chamomile and brioche. Notes of lemon curd and Asian pear intermingle with a firm structure and lengthy finish. Vineyard Notes Oregon wines with a signature style of elegance and restraint, Gran Moraine produces Chardonnay, Pinot Noir, and sparkling wines from the Willamette Valley. Our estate vineyards, Gran Moraine Vineyard and our Winery Estate Vineyard, perch on the oldest marine sedimentary-based soils in the Yamhill-Carlton sub-AVA of the northern Willamette Valley. Our wines showcase Winemaker Shane Moore’s tireless attention to detail in both the vineyard and the winery, which translates to precision and elegance in the bottle. At Gran Moraine, we believe in picking fruit on the cusp of ripeness to maintain the most pure, intense, and expressive fruit characteristics. With its cool climate, the Yamhill-Carlton sub-AVA has temperate growing conditions that allow for longer hang-time on the vine, which help to preserve the acidity and promote the nuanced fruit and earth characteristics that are a signature of Gran Moraine wines. The end result is a collection of Pinot Noirs and Chardonnays that showcase Gran Moraine’s unwavering attention to detail in both the vineyard and the winery. Always offering balance over opulence and a fresh through-line of acidity, Gran Moraine wines uniquely showcase a complex, feminine, and delicate facet of the Yamhill-Carlton AVA.
